Recently, Kylie Kelce, the wife of legendary NFL center Jason Kelce, pulled back the curtain on the toll that this sudden, massive exposure is taking on her family, particularly her four young daughters. Her honest, vulnerable reflection has ignited a firestorm of debate, splitting the internet and raising uncomfortable questions about the price of fame in the digital age.

The fire began during a recent, intimate moment on the family’s podcast. When asked if her children enjoyed the growing attention surrounding their family, Kylie’s response was immediate and stark: “First of all, yuck.” She explained that while her young daughters initially found the situation somewhat amusing—even playing games where they pretended to be fans asking for autographs—the novelty has quickly worn off. The reality of being recognized in public, having strangers stare at them, and hearing people talk about approaching them has become an unwelcome intrusion into their childhood.

Kylie described a particularly telling moment where her oldest daughter, Wyatt, reacted with protective anger toward a group of women who were staring at them, loudly stating, “They are not taking a picture with my dad.” For Kylie, this was a heartbreaking realization. “It makes me sad that this is their reality,” she admitted, emphasizing that her primary goal as a mother is to provide her children with as normal an upbringing as possible. This sentiment, which many parents would find inherently sympathetic, was met with a surprisingly aggressive backlash from a segment of the internet.

Critics were quick to point out what they perceived as a glaring contradiction. They argued that because Jason and Kylie participate in high-profile podcasts, have been featured in documentaries, and have built a brand centered on their family dynamics, they cannot reasonably complain about the public’s interest. The comments section quickly filled with accusations of hypocrisy, with some users suggesting that the couple wants the benefits of fame—such as influence and financial gain—without the inevitable loss of privacy. The reaction was a harsh reminder of how quickly the tide of public opinion can turn, transforming a mother’s vulnerable confession into a full-blown controversy.
